Output 30a062ddafd7d2b8a53193a94392da7d5d417b916e571df1a91ba6936464c093:3

value
89423447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2f176be3fa7b937c18fe780b87142a9e4eb3f16 OP_EQUAL
address
3PqaiAj18j2up9biZqHNZSAcpiB7vHZFD2
transaction
30a062ddafd7d2b8a53193a94392da7d5d417b916e571df1a91ba6936464c093
spent
true